I’m a Software Engineer at Google with experience designing and scaling complex systems. I help software engineers prepare for technical interviews, improve their coding and system design skills, and navigate career growth in big tech.
I offer flexible mentorship—from one-time sessions (mock interviews, resume reviews, Q&A) to ongoing career guidance. Whether you’re aiming to land your first big tech role, prepare for senior-level interviews, or sharpen your engineering skills, I can provide practical, actionable advice from firsthand experience.
My focus areas include: interview prep (DSA, system design), distributed systems, backend development, cloud infrastructure, and career coaching.
● Successfully handled over 80% of backend refactoring, transitioning from a normal forms model to a workflow model, and enhancing the...
● Successfully handled over 80% of backend refactoring, transitioning from a normal forms model to a workflow model, and enhancing the procurement process. This refactoring led to an increase in sales results by 100%.
● Authored and implemented tests that covered nearly 80% of the application, ensuring robust and reliable software performance. Documented all endpoints, significantly improving code maintainability and team collaboration efficiency.
● Developed and integrated a robust vector search mechanism to enhance search functionalities, leveraging AI to significantly improve search accuracy and user experience. Optimized algorithm parameters to reduce search latency by 30% and increase retrieval precision.
● Spearheaded the integration of advanced natural language processing tools (LangChain and LangSmith) to enhance content generation and language understanding capabilities. This integration improved process efficiency by 40% and enriched user interactions with more coherent and contextually relevant responses.
● I started a software agency when I solicited freelancing projects on Upwork.
● Studied business management and applied my learni...
● I started a software agency when I solicited freelancing projects on Upwork.
● Studied business management and applied my learnings to increase growth.
● Recruited, led, and mentored more than eight developers.
● Raised a 100K USD pre-seed round from an Egypt-based VC.